History Of That Place

Telkupi Eco Village is a recent development in the Panchet area and was established with the aim of promoting eco-tourism in the region. The village is situated amidst lush green forests and is surrounded by hills, making it an ideal spot for nature lovers.

Best Time To Visit

The best time to visit Telkupi Eco Village is between October to February when the weather is pleasant and cool. This is the ideal time to explore the forests and enjoy the natural beauty of the region.

How To Reach

Telkupi Eco Village is situated around 250 km from Kolkata, the capital city of West Bengal. The nearest railway station is Asansol Railway Station, which is around 40 km away. From the station, you can hire a taxi or take a bus to reach the village. The nearest airport is Netaji Subhash Chandra Bose International Airport in Kolkata, from where you can hire a taxi or take a bus to reach the village.

Places To Visit

Panchet Dam: Panchet Dam is one of the largest dams in West Bengal and is situated on the Damodar River. The dam offers a panoramic view of the surrounding hills and is a popular picnic spot.

 

Joychandi Pahar: Joychandi Pahar is a popular hill station located around 12 km from Telkupi Eco Village. The hill offers breathtaking views of the surrounding forests and is a popular trekking destination.

Maithon Dam: Maithon Dam is another popular tourist attraction located around 30 km from Telkupi Eco Village. The dam offers a scenic view of the surrounding hills and is a popular picnic spot.

Kalyaneshwari Temple: Kalyaneshwari Temple is a famous Hindu temple located around 60 km from Telkupi Eco Village. The temple is dedicated to the goddess Kalyaneshwari and is a popular pilgrimage destination.
